- Title
Collision modeling and two-echelon collaborative control of non-contact ultra-quiet Stewart spacecraft.
- Authors
He Liao; Xiande Wu; Yufei Xu; Xinzhu Sun; Zhipeng Wang
- Abstract
This article presents the collision modeling and two-echelon collaborative control of a novel non-contact ultra-quiet Stewart spacecraft. It has internal instability because of its non-contact configuration. To overcome the instability, the equivalent modeling of repetitive collision process with small releasing velocity is established at first. Then, a two-echelon collaborative control is developed to guarantee both collision rejection and stability performance. Finally, the numerical simulation is conducted to demonstrate the validity and effectiveness of the proposed design
